Basic Survival Tools
Knife
A knife is an essential tool for survival. It can be used for various purposes such as cutting, chopping, and self-defense. In a survival situation, a reliable knife can help you build shelter, prepare food, and create tools. It is important to choose a knife that is durable, sharp, and easy to handle. Additionally, it is crucial to learn proper knife techniques and safety precautions to avoid accidents. With a good knife by your side, you can increase your chances of surviving in the wilderness.
Firestarter
A firestarter is an essential tool for survival in the wilderness. It is used to ignite fires quickly and efficiently, providing warmth, light, and a means to cook food. There are various types of firestarters available, including flint and steel, waterproof matches, and ferrocerium rods. These tools are compact, lightweight, and easy to use, making them ideal for outdoor enthusiasts and adventurers. Whether you are camping, hiking, or facing an emergency situation, a firestarter is a must-have tool to ensure your survival and comfort.
Water purification
Water purification is a crucial aspect of survival, especially in situations where clean water sources are scarce. Having the right tools for water purification can mean the difference between life and death. There are various methods of purifying water, such as boiling, using water filters, or using chemical treatments. Each method has its advantages and disadvantages, and it is important to be well-equipped with the necessary tools to ensure the safety of the water you consume. Additionally, it is essential to have knowledge of different water sources and how to identify and avoid contaminated water. By understanding the importance of water purification and having the appropriate tools, you can increase your chances of survival in challenging environments.
Shelter Building Tools
Tarp
A tarp is an essential tool for survival in the outdoors. It provides protection from rain, wind, and sun, and can be used to create a shelter or cover for belongings. Tarpaulins are lightweight, durable, and easy to pack, making them a versatile tool for any survival situation. Whether you’re camping, hiking, or in an emergency situation, having a tarp in your survival kit is a must.
Paracord
Paracord is an essential tool for survivalists and outdoor enthusiasts. Made from nylon, it is a lightweight and durable rope that can be used in a variety of ways. Whether it’s for building a shelter, creating a makeshift clothesline, or securing gear, paracord is a versatile resource that should always be included in a survival kit. Its high tensile strength and ability to withstand harsh conditions make it a reliable tool in emergency situations. Additionally, paracord can be unraveled to reveal multiple inner strands that can be used for sewing, fishing, or even as a tourniquet. When it comes to survival, having paracord on hand can make all the difference.
Tent
A tent is one of the most essential survival tools. It provides shelter and protection from the elements, such as rain, wind, and extreme temperatures. A good quality tent should be durable, lightweight, and easy to set up. It should also have proper ventilation to prevent condensation inside. When choosing a tent for survival purposes, consider the number of people it can accommodate, the season it is designed for, and the terrain you will be camping in. Investing in a reliable tent is crucial for ensuring your safety and comfort in the wilderness.
Navigation Tools
Compass
A compass is an essential tool for survival in the wilderness. It is used to determine direction and navigate through unfamiliar terrain. Whether you are hiking, camping, or exploring, a compass can help you find your way back to safety. By understanding how to read a compass and use it in conjunction with a map, you can confidently navigate your surroundings and avoid getting lost. Additionally, a compass does not rely on technology or batteries, making it a reliable tool that will not fail you in critical situations. In summary, a compass is a must-have tool for any outdoor enthusiast or adventurer.
Map
A map is an essential tool for survival in any situation. It provides valuable information about the surrounding area, including landmarks, water sources, and potential hazards. With a map, you can navigate through unfamiliar terrain, plan your route, and find your way back to safety. Whether you’re exploring the wilderness or navigating through a city, a map is a reliable companion that can help you make informed decisions and increase your chances of survival.
GPS device
A GPS device is an essential tool for survival in the wilderness. It allows you to accurately determine your location, track your progress, and navigate through unfamiliar terrain. With a GPS device, you can easily find your way back to a safe location or communicate your coordinates to rescue teams in case of an emergency. Additionally, some GPS devices come with additional features such as weather updates, topographic maps, and compasses, making them even more valuable for survival situations. Whether you are hiking, camping, or exploring remote areas, a GPS device is a reliable and indispensable tool for ensuring your safety and survival.
Food Gathering Tools
Fishing gear
When it comes to fishing gear, having the right tools can make all the difference in a survival situation. A sturdy fishing rod and reel, along with a variety of hooks, lines, and sinkers, are essential for catching fish. Additionally, a fishing net can be useful for capturing larger fish or multiple fish at once. It’s also important to have a good supply of bait, such as worms or artificial lures, to attract fish. Finally, a fish scaler and fillet knife are necessary for cleaning and preparing the catch. With the proper fishing gear, you can increase your chances of finding a valuable food source in the wild.
Hunting equipment
When it comes to hunting, having the right equipment is crucial. A well-prepared hunter understands the importance of having reliable and effective tools. From rifles and bows to camouflage clothing and hunting boots, the right gear can make all the difference in a successful hunt. Additionally, accessories such as binoculars, rangefinders, and game calls can enhance the hunting experience and increase the chances of spotting and attracting game. It is important to invest in high-quality hunting equipment that is suitable for the type of hunting you plan to do. By having the right tools, you can maximize your chances of a successful and enjoyable hunting trip.
Traps and snares
Traps and snares are essential tools for survival in the wilderness. These devices are designed to catch or immobilize animals, providing a source of food and increasing your chances of survival. There are various types of traps and snares that can be used, including deadfall traps, snare wires, and pit traps. It is important to learn how to construct and set up these traps properly to ensure their effectiveness. Additionally, understanding the behavior and habits of the target animals can greatly improve your success rate. Mastering the art of trapping and snaring is a valuable skill that can greatly enhance your survival capabilities in any outdoor situation.
First Aid Tools
Bandages
Bandages are an essential tool for survival in emergency situations. They are used to provide support and protection to wounds, helping to stop bleeding and prevent further injury. Bandages come in various sizes and types, including adhesive bandages, gauze bandages, and elastic bandages. It is important to have a well-stocked first aid kit that includes a variety of bandages to handle different types of injuries. In addition to their medical uses, bandages can also be used for other purposes such as securing splints or creating makeshift slings. Having bandages readily available can make a significant difference in treating injuries and increasing the chances of survival in challenging environments.
Antiseptics
Antiseptics are essential tools for survival in various situations. They help prevent the growth of harmful microorganisms and reduce the risk of infection. In a survival scenario, where access to medical facilities may be limited, antiseptics can be used to clean wounds, cuts, and abrasions, promoting faster healing and preventing complications. Common antiseptics include hydrogen peroxide, iodine, and alcohol-based solutions. It is important to have a supply of antiseptics in your survival kit to ensure proper hygiene and minimize the chances of infection in emergency situations.
Medications
Medications play a crucial role in survival situations. Whether it’s treating injuries, managing chronic conditions, or preventing infections, having the right medications can make a significant difference in one’s ability to survive. In a survival scenario, it is important to have a well-stocked first aid kit that includes essential medications such as pain relievers, antibiotics, antiseptics, and anti-inflammatory drugs. Additionally, individuals with chronic conditions should ensure they have an ample supply of their prescribed medications to manage their health effectively. It is also important to regularly check the expiration dates of medications and replace them as needed to maintain their efficacy. By being prepared with the necessary medications, individuals can increase their chances of staying healthy and resilient in challenging survival situations.
